About Varda

Low Earth orbit is open for business. Varda is accelerating the development of commercial space infrastructure, from in-orbit pharmaceutical processing to reliable and economical reentry capsules. 

From life-saving pharmaceuticals to more powerful fiber optics, there is a world of products used on Earth today that can only be manufactured in space. Varda is accelerating innovation in the orbital economy by creating both the products and infrastructure needed so space can directly benefit life on Earth. Our mission is to expand the economic bounds of humankind. 

Our team is uniquely suited to accomplishing this goal, with leadership and staff comprised of veterans from SpaceX, Blue Origin, major pharmaceutical companies and Silicon Valley. Varda was founded in January 2021 by Will Bruey and Delian Asparouhov with significant backing from world class investors including Khosla Ventures, Lux Capital, Founders Fund, Caffeinated Capital, General Catalyst, and Also Capital. 

Varda is headquartered in El Segundo, California, where we have offices and a production facility where our vehicles, equipment, and materials are built, integrated, and tested. Varda also has offices in Washington, DC and Huntsville, AL.

About This Role

As a Supply Chain Engineer- Avionics/Electro-Mechanical focused, you'll be instrumental in ensuring the seamless integration of engineering and manufacturing capabilities with our supplier network. You'll collaborate closely with supply chain, engineering, and production teams to ensure that our suppliers can meet our rigorous standards and deliver components that align with our design specifications. This role will involve both hands-on evaluation of supplier processes and strategic initiatives to enhance supplier performance. You'll be responsible for assessing manufacturing capabilities, interpreting engineering drawings, and driving improvements that support our mission as we continue to innovate and expand. 

This is a full-time onsite role based in our El Segundo headquarters.

Responsibilities

  • Own supplier quality – create framework for Varda’s supplier quality programs
  • Supplier-facing work specifically on avionics commodities: PCBAs, wire harnesses, connectors, avionics boxes – including full avionics assembly
  • Collaborate with engineering teams on new product introduction and R&D projects, providing Designed for Manufacturability (DFM) input and supplier selection throughout the development lifecycle
  • Work closely with the supply chain team to evaluate potential suppliers, conduct supplier audits, and assess their capabilities, and quality control processes
  • Define and implement robust quality requirements for suppliers, including specifications, inspection and acceptance criteria, in collaboration with engineering and operations teams
  • Build relationships with suppliers to drive continuous improvement of quality control processes
  • Investigate and resolve supplier quality issues through root cause analysis and corrective actions
  • Participate in design reviews, risk assessments, and qualification activities to ensure supplier quality considerations are addressed during the product development lifecycle
  • Stay updated with industry trends, standards, and regulations related to supplier quality and manufacturing in the aerospace sector  

Basic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ering or a related degree (electrical, mechanical, aerospace, etc.)
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in supplier quality engineering, preferably in the aerospace, automotive, or high-performance engineering industries
  • Demonstrated fluency with avionics hardware experience at the box, harness, or board level
  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ills, with a keen attention to detail
  • Knowledge of quality tools such as FMEA, DMAIC, 8D, etc.
  • Understanding of engineering models and drawings
  • Ability to travel 25-50% of the time  

Preferred Qualifications

  • Expert level knowledge in one or more commodities within the team's scope (*PCB/PCBA manufacturing, mechanical machining, propulsion systems, etc)
  • Strong interpersonal and collaborative skills, and enthusiasm for Varda’s spirit of innovation and drive for improving reliability in cutting-edge technology
  • Proven ability to evaluate supplier capabilities, conduct audits, and drive continuous improvement of supplier quality control processes
  • Proficiency in quality management systems such as AS9100 or ISO 9001, and familiarity with other relevant quality standards and regulations
  • Familiarity with space system components and materials, including *electrical, *electronic components, mechanical and their associated quality requirements
  • Thorough understanding of GD&T (ANSI Y14.5-2009 or 2018) for chassis/enclosure and harness routing in this domain
  • IPC-A-610 or IPC-J-STD familiarity

ITAR Requirements

  • Varda, like all employers, must ensure that its employees working in the United States are lawfully authorized to work in the U.S.  Additionally, our employees are exposed to and have access to certain export-controlled items. At present, some of our technology to which employees have access requires a license to be exported to individuals other than “U.S. Persons” as defined in U.S. export regulations. Because our employees are provided access to export-controlled items, our current policy is to only hire “U.S. persons” who are permitted to have access to our technology without an export license. 

    “US person” means: U.S. citizen, U.S. lawful permanent resident, or protected individual as defined by 8 U.S.C. 1324b(a)(3) (i.e., individual admitted to the U.S. as a refugee or granted asylum in the U.S.)
